The Origins and Evolution of Progesterone
Progesterone’s story begins not in a laboratory, but in the womb of evolutionary biology. Discovered in 1934 by German chemist Adolf Butenandt, progesterone was isolated from the corpus luteum of cow ovaries—a breakthrough that earned him a Nobel Prize in Chemistry. Yet, its role in human physiology had been hinted at long before, in the ancient practices of herbalism and midwifery. Traditional healers in cultures from Ayurveda to Chinese medicine recognized the importance of hormonal balance, though they lacked the scientific language to describe it. Progesterone, derived from the Latin *pro* (for) and *gestatio* (pregnancy), was named for its pivotal role in preparing the uterine lining for implantation—a function so critical that its absence could mean the difference between a thriving pregnancy and a miscarriage. But progesterone’s influence doesn’t stop at reproduction; it’s a master regulator, interacting with nearly every system in the body, from the brain to the bones.
The 20th century brought progesterone into the spotlight of modern medicine, particularly with the advent of birth control pills in the 1960s. Synthetic progestins, designed to mimic progesterone, became a cornerstone of women’s healthcare, offering control over fertility and relief from menstrual symptoms. However, this synthetic approach came with unintended consequences: studies later revealed links between progestins and increased risks of blood clots, breast cancer, and mood disturbances. The pendulum swung back toward natural solutions, sparking a resurgence in interest in bioidentical hormones—molecules identical to those produced by the human body. Today, the conversation around progesterone is more nuanced, acknowledging that while synthetic hormones have their place, the body often responds better to the natural, cyclical rhythms of its own production.

Key Characteristics and Core Features
Progesterone is far more than a reproductive hormone; it’s a multifunctional molecule with roles that span the body’s systems. At its core, progesterone is a steroid hormone derived from cholesterol, produced primarily in the ovaries (in women) and the adrenal glands (in both genders). Its primary function is to prepare the uterine lining for a fertilized egg, but its influence extends to the brain, where it acts as a neurosteroid, modulating GABA receptors to promote relaxation and reduce anxiety. This is why progesterone is often called the “anti-anxiety hormone”—its calming effects are well-documented, particularly during the luteal phase of the menstrual cycle, when levels naturally peak.
The mechanics of progesterone production are tightly regulated by the hypothalamic-pituitary-ovarian (HPO) axis, a feedback loop that responds to signals from the brain. Stress, poor nutrition, and environmental toxins can disrupt this axis, leading to imbalances. For example, chronic cortisol elevation (from stress or poor sleep) can deplete progesterone levels, creating a vicious cycle where low progesterone exacerbates stress and vice versa. Additionally, progesterone supports thyroid function by converting T4 to the active T3 hormone, meaning thyroid imbalances can further complicate progesterone dynamics. Understanding these interactions is key to how to naturally increase progesterone, as addressing one system often has ripple effects on others.
Progesterone also plays a critical role in bone health, working synergistically with estrogen to maintain density. Low progesterone levels are associated with an increased risk of osteoporosis, particularly in postmenopausal women. Its anti-inflammatory properties further underscore its importance, as inflammation is a common denominator in many hormonal imbalances. The body’s ability to produce progesterone is also influenced by lifestyle factors such as exercise, sleep, and exposure to endocrine disruptors like BPA and phthalates, which mimic estrogen and throw off the delicate hormonal balance.
